muddled mission

1 1/2 oz Anchor Junipero Gin (Beefeater)
1 oz St. Germain Elderflower Liqueur
1/4 oz Yellow Chartreuse
3/4 oz Lemon Juice
1 Strawberry

Muddle strawberry, add rest of ingredients and ice, shake, and double strain into a coupe. Garnish with an additional strawberry.
Two Fridays ago, I wanted to make use of the strawberries in my refrigerator, so I turned to the Death & Co. Cocktail Book where I had spotted a few recipes in the past. The one that called out to me was Joaquin Simo's 2008 Muddled Mission. Once prepped, the drink offered strawberry, pine, and floral notes to the nose. Lemon with berry on the sip gave way to gin, herbal, pear, and floral flavors on the swallow with a strawberry finish.
